Attic Bathroom Remodeling in Norwalk, CT
Attic bathroom remodeling services involve transforming an underutilized attic space into a functional and comfortable bathroom. These projects typically include installing plumbing, electrical systems, flooring, fixtures, and ventilation to create a cohesive and efficient bathroom environment. Homeowners often seek these services to maximize their home's square footage, improve convenience, or add value to their property, especially when traditional bathroom locations are limited or unavailable.
Before requesting attic bathroom remodeling, property owners should consider factors such as the existing structural layout, ceiling height, access points, and potential need for reinforcement or insulation. Understanding the scope of work, including any necessary permits or structural modifications, helps ensure the project aligns with building codes and safety standards. Clear planning and communication about desired features and budget considerations are essential for a successful transformation of the attic space into a functional bathroom.

Attic Bathroom Remodeling Questions
What types of attic bathroom renovations are common? Typical projects include adding a new bathroom, upgrading fixtures, improving insulation, and enhancing ventilation systems for better comfort and functionality.
Is attic space suitable for a bathroom? Attics can be converted into bathrooms if there is enough space, proper plumbing access, and adequate ceiling height to meet building standards.
What should property owners consider before remodeling an attic bathroom? It’s important to evaluate structural support, plumbing and electrical access, ventilation options, and moisture control measures.
Are there design options that maximize small attic bathroom spaces? Yes, compact fixtures, vertical storage solutions, and light color schemes can help make small attic bathrooms more functional and appealing.
